I agree with Searz.

I tried this long ago (LONG ago), and it simply didn't work.

Why? Because the meta changes so quickly, and buffs/nerfs and new discoveries (revolver vlad!) happen so fast that unless you're willing to watch streams hours per day and look at all the current bans/picks and keep up with the meta and keep the guide updated on a near-daily basis, it just won't happen. Things move more quickly than your guide can ever move.

If anyone really wants to know the up-to-date bans/picks, then go watch a stream or two and note the champions they're banning. Tournaments are good for noting picks, provided you know which champs are just player preferences (for instance, scarra plays katarina but she's not considered tier 1 despite scarra kicking *** with her). Bans are harder to discern from tournaments because 90% of bans are to counter the enemy, who they know plays a certain champ.

TL:DR dont do it. You can't keep up.
